Kate’s Bars Taps Terra Public Relations As Communications Partner

Posted: 08/30/2010 In Category: Outdoor New Products

Industry News Release Written By: Alli Noland

Victor, ID (August 31, 2010) -- Kate’s Bars, LLC has hired Terra Public Relations as Communications Partner, effective immediately. Responsibilities include public relations efforts, including overseeing media introduction, communications and product and brand conversations for the Kate’s Bars brand.

About Kate’s Bars
Kate’s Bars are real food snack bars, hand made in the shadow of the Tetons. Kate’s Bars are created for people who live, play or just want to be outdoors. The flavors and textures of Kate’s Bars are designed to reflect the natural surroundings they were inspired by.
